Ingredients For applesauce cookies
-
2eggs
-
1 csugar
-
1/2 cshortening
-
1 capplesauce
-
1/2 tspground cinnamon
-
1/2 tspground cloves
-
1/2 tspground alspice
-
1 tspbaking soda
-
1 tspsalt
-
1 tspvanila
-
2 cflour
-
2 cchocolate chips
How To Make applesauce cookies
-
1Pre-heat oven to 350 degrees.
-
2Crack the 2 eggs in mixing bowl, beat well. Add sugar and shortening and applesauce, beat till smooth.
-
3Add to mixing bowl the cinnamon,cloves,allspice,baking soda,salt and vanilla. Mix in. Pour in flour while beating, beat well. Stir in chocolate chips.
-
4Drop by tablespoon on ungreased cookie sheet. Bake at 350 7-9 minutes. (Cookies should be soft). Place on cooling rack.
